On 7 April 2012 20:07, Antony Shimmin <[email protected]> wrote: > Hi there, > > I have Ajax Pagination (sort of) working on my Ruby on Rails Project. > > However my problem is, is that it repeats each page x number of times, x > being equal to the amount of records I have on each page. > > So lets say for example prior to the Ajax Pagination, I had 12 records > per page, now I have each record on that page replicated 12 times. > > I render a partial as follows. > > <table width="500" border="1" align="center" class="gridtable" id="meh"> > <tr id="table2"> > > <th height="26" scope="col">Username</th> > <th scope="col">Date Leaving</th> > <th scope="col">Date Submitted</th> > <th scope="col">Approved</th> > <th scope="col">Date Updated</th> > </tr> > <% div_for for holidays in @holidays%>
That should be "for holiday in" not "for holidays in" Have a look at the Rails Guide on Debugging, it will show you how to debug code so you can work out such problems yourself.
